[QUOTE="HuskyHawk, post: 3223632, member: 1414"] Those KenPom numbers aren’t what determines anything. They are a predictive measure that he adjusts after they fail or succeed at predicting. In this case they were obviously wrong. And you can’t compare numbers one season to the next. It’s meaningless. My memory of 1999 was that there were two teams at #1 all year, Duke or UConn. MSU was a clear #3 and everybody else was meh. The level of talent that year wasn’t high. So a very good Duke team looked better by those metrics than it was. Plenty of other teams in that era would have beaten them. And UConn was the better team in 1999, clearly. So that reveals what? It reveals that KenPom adjEM isn’t a stat that tells you who the best teams are. It almost never is. It’s flawed. [/QUOTE]
